PH DEPENDENCE OF THE STABILITY CONSTANTS OF COPPER(I) COMPLEXES WITH FUMARIC AND MALEIC ACIDS IN AQUEOUS SOLUTIONS

摘要

The stability constants of the copper(I) pi-complexes with the different acidic forms of fumaric and maleic acids (H2L, HL- and L2-) were derived as (0.23, 1.2 and 2.8) X 10(4) M-1 (maleic acid) and (0.73, 1.1 and 1.5) X 10(4) M-1 (fumaric acid), respectively, by either electrochemical or pulse radiolytic techniques. The influence of electron-donating/withdrawing substituents on the pi-ligands are discussed. [References: 25]
